Learning Journals Coming Home


All Riverside classrooms will be sending home learning journals during conferences or next week. Students all have learning journals that they add to throughout the year to keep track of their progress on grade level learning targets and personal goals. We will be sending them home a few times this year school-wide in order to keep communicating with families about progress and keep the conversations going. Please see the attached documents for more information and also some discussion prompts that you can use with your child as you look it over with him/her and send back the following week. Cell Phone Policy/Apple Watches


Please take a minute to review the cell phone, apple watch, electronic device policy below with your child. As you know, safety and learning are our two biggest priorities. We have noticed that sometimes devices are interfering with both of those things when they are out during the day or students are using their apple watches to communicate. If your child does need to get a hold of you during the day or vice versa, their classroom teacher and our office will always help with a standard phone call. Students texting during the day is not allowed and can be a distraction. Thank you for your cooperation!

From Our Health Room

There has been a slight uptick in viral/bacterial infections. If your child is coughing a lot or has a fever, we encourage you to keep them home to rest.


Does your child need medication?


Sometimes students need medication to be administered during the day by our staff in the health room. There are specific forms linked below that need to be filled out before we are authorized to dispense that medication - prescription or over the counter medication. Also, please keep in mind that parents/guardians should always transport that medication and drop off in our office. If you have any questions, please give us a call.

Want to help?


There are many opportunities to help out at school. Whether helping in the classroom, at PTO events or chaperoning a field trip, we'd love your help.


To ensure that all adults who come in contact with your children are safe to do so, we run background checks on all volunteers. You can apply today to be a volunteer at the link below. Please note that it does take 48-96 hours for the process, so if you want to volunteer, apply early.
